The Science Behind Neutral Silicone Sealant


Unlike acidic sealants that release vinegar-like fumes during curing, neutral silicone sealant uses a different chemical approach. This 'neutral' formulation means less odor and better compatibility with sensitive materials like natural stone, certain plastics, and even some metals. The silicone base gives it flexibility that lasts for years, while the neutral pH prevents corrosion or discoloration on surfaces you care about.

Adhesion That Actually Sticks Around


One of the biggest headaches with sealants is poor adhesion. You apply it, it seems to stick, then months later it peels away. Neutral silicone sealant tackles this problem head-on. Its unique formula creates strong chemical bonds with a wide range of materials - from glass and ceramics to concrete and painted surfaces. This means your seal stays put through temperature swings, moisture, and even mild cleaning chemicals.

Applications Where Neutral Silicone Sealant Shines


The beauty of neutral silicone sealant lies in its versatility. Homeowners love it for kitchen and bathroom renovations - sealing around sinks, showers, and backsplashes. Contractors use it for window and door installations where a flexible, weatherproof seal is critical. Even DIY enthusiasts appreciate how easily it applies and cleans up compared to traditional caulks.


But wait, there's more! Industrial applications abound too. From sealing electrical enclosures to creating gaskets in machinery, the neutral formulation means no risk of chemical reactions with sensitive components.
